Pluto Manager is the dedicated programming software for ABB’s Pluto Safety PLCs, designed to configure and manage industrial safety systems. It provides a user-friendly environment for creating safety functions using ladder logic and pre-approved TÜV function blocks, which simplify the design of high-integrity safety systems. Key Features of Pluto Manager
Safety Programming: Supports ladder logic and function block programming to define machine safety reactions.
Project Overview: Offers a structured view of all Pluto units, gateways, and peripheral components within a network.
Monitoring and Diagnostics: Includes tools for real-time monitoring of safety bus signals and detailed system diagnostics to troubleshoot faults. Searching for a " Pluto Manager registration key
Hardware Compatibility: Works with various Pluto models, including those with analog inputs, counter inputs for encoders, and bus communication for larger systems.
Predefined Libraries: Comes with standard libraries of safety functions to ensure compliance with safety ratings like PL e/SIL3. Registration and Licensing
While the Pluto Manager software itself is often provided free of charge by ABB, a license key is required to perform specific critical actions, such as loading program code into a Pluto module. Pluto - Programmable safety controllers - ABB

Pluto Manager is a specialized PC-based software used to program and monitor the ABB Jokab Safety PLC Pluto
. While the software itself is often provided by the manufacturer, full functionality—specifically the ability to download program code to a Pluto module—requires a valid registration license key Core Features of Pluto Manager Ladder Logic & Function Blocks
: Programming is primarily done using ladder logic, supplemented by TÜV-approved function blocks
to simplify the design of safety functions like emergency stops and two-hand controls. System Overview
: It provides a structured view of all Pluto units, gateways, and peripheral components (sensors/actuators) within a project. Multi-Device Management : A single project can accommodate up to 32 Pluto units
and 4 Gateways, which can share global variables across the safety bus. Diagnostic Tools
: The software includes online monitoring capabilities to view real-time status and diagnostic functions to export data. Registration & Key Requirements License Key Access
: To load or download code into a Pluto module, a license key is mandatory. Obtaining a Key
: Users typically obtain a registration code by contacting their local ABB sales representative
or technical support. You may need to provide company information to receive the code.
: Upon installation, users have the option to run the software in a free demo mode
, which allows for project creation and simulation but restricts downloading to hardware. Technical Workflow Project Setup
: Create a new project and add the specific Pluto model being used (e.g., Pluto D45). Configuration : Define inputs and outputs for each unit individually. Compilation
: Save and compile the program to check for errors; a "green" compilation is required before the software permits a download. Hardware Connection
: Use a special ABB serial programming cable (4-pin to USB) to connect the PC to the PLC.
: Enter the registration key if prompted, select the correct COM port in preferences, and initiate the download. between Pluto Manager and the PLC? Programmable safety controllers - ABB

The notion of a "top" or "best" repack is an illusion. Repack ratings on pirate sites are easily manipulated. A single uploader can use dozens of fake accounts to upvote their own file. Moreover, even a repack that works perfectly today may be retroactively weaponized tomorrow if the uploader updates the file with malware after gaining trust.
Security researchers call this the "poisoned well" strategy: crack distributors build a reputation with clean files for months, then push one massive malware-laced update. By then, thousands have downloaded it.
